Understanding LED A19 Technology

What is LED A19?

The led a19 bulb is a popular type of light bulb that features a traditional A19 shape, characterized by its rounded body and standard base, making it compatible with most household fixtures. Unlike incandescent bulbs, LED A19 bulbs utilize light-emitting diodes, which are more energy-efficient. They provide instant brightness and are available in various color temperatures that cater to different lighting needs and preferences.

Benefits of Using LED A19

One of the key advantages of LED A19 bulbs is their energy efficiency. They consume significantly less power—up to 80% less than their incandescent counterparts—while delivering the same brightness. Additionally, LED A19 bulbs have an extended lifespan, often lasting up to 25,000 hours or more, reducing the frequency and cost of replacement.

Another benefit is their lower heat emission. Unlike incandescent bulbs that waste energy by converting it into heat, LED A19 bulbs remain cool to the touch, making them safer to use in various settings, including homes with children or pets. Furthermore, LED technology is more environmentally friendly, as these bulbs are free of toxic materials like mercury and are 100% recyclable.

Comparing LED A19 to Traditional Bulbs

When comparing LED A19 bulbs with traditional incandescent bulbs, the differences are striking. While a standard incandescent bulb produces about 15 lumens per watt, an LED A19 can produce over 80 lumens per watt, making it far more efficient. This efficiency translates into substantial savings on energy bills, especially for households that rely heavily on lighting.

Additionally, LED A19 bulbs are more durable. They are less susceptible to breakage due to their solid state, unlike fragile incandescents. Over time, this robustness and efficiency make LED A19 a favorite choice for homeowners looking to modernize their lighting while saving on energy and replacement costs.

Choosing the Right LED A19 Bulb

Wattage and Brightness Considerations

When selecting an LED A19 bulb, it’s important to consider wattage and brightness. LED bulbs are available in varying wattages, typically ranging from 8 to 14 watts, which can replace traditional 60-watt, 75-watt, or even 100-watt incandescent bulbs. To determine the right wattage for your needs, consider the brightness measured in lumens. For general lighting, a bulb that emits at least 800 lumens is preferable.

For specific tasks or areas requiring more light, such as kitchens or workspaces, a higher lumen output may be necessary. Checking the manufacturer’s packaging for lumen ratings can help you make informed decisions.

Color Temperature Options for LED A19

Color temperature is a vital factor in setting the mood of a room. LED A19 bulbs come in various color temperatures measured in Kelvin (K). Common options include:

  • Warm White (2700K): Ideal for creating a cozy and inviting atmosphere, perfect for living areas and bedrooms.
  • Soft White (3000K): Slightly cooler than warm white, this temperature provides balanced light suitable for most rooms.
  • Cool White (4000K): This option offers a bright light suitable for workspaces and kitchens.
  • Daylight (5000K-6500K): This color temperature mimics natural daylight, ideal for reading and detail-oriented tasks.

Choosing the correct color temperature will enhance your space’s functionality and ambiance, making it essential to consider personal preferences and room usage.

Installing LED A19 Bulbs Safely

Tools Needed for Installation

Installing LED A19 bulbs is a straightforward process that typically requires no special tools; however, having the right tools can make the task easier. Here’s a list of some useful tools:

  • Non-slip gloves (optional for handling bulbs)
  • A ladder (if reaching high fixtures)
  • A clean cloth or paper towel (to hold the bulb during installation)

It’s essential to ensure that the light fixture is switched off before attempting to replace any bulbs to avoid any electric shock.

Step-by-Step Installation Guide

Follow this simple guide to install your LED A19 bulbs:

  1. Turn off the power to the light fixture at the circuit breaker or light switch.
  2. If replacing an old bulb, gently twist the bulb counterclockwise to remove it.
  3. Clean the socket if needed, ensuring there is no dust or debris.
  4. Take your new LED A19 bulb and gently insert it into the socket.
  5. Twist the bulb clockwise until it is secure and snug.
  6. Turn the power back on and test the bulb.

By following these simple steps, you’ll have your LED A19 bulbs installed safely and effectively.

Common Installation Mistakes to Avoid

While installing LED A19 bulbs is generally uneventful, some common mistakes can occur:

  • Not Turning Off the Power: Always ensure the power is off to prevent electric shock.
  • Over-Tightening the Bulb: Avoid twisting the bulb too tightly, as this can damage the fixture or bulb.
  • Using the Wrong Wattage: Verify the fixture’s maximum wattage to ensure compatibility.

Being aware of these pitfalls will ensure a smooth and safe installation process.

Combining LED A19 with Smart Home Technology

Many modern LED A19 bulbs are compatible with smart home systems, allowing you to control them via smartphone apps, voice commands, or automation schedules. Smart LED A19 bulbs can adjust brightness, change colors, and even sync with music, providing enhanced control over your home atmosphere. When selecting smart LED A19 bulbs, ensure they are compatible with your existing system for seamless integration.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How long do LED A19 bulbs typically last?

LED A19 bulbs can last up to 25,000 hours, depending on usage and environmental conditions, far exceeding traditional incandescent bulbs.

2. Can I use LED A19 bulbs in enclosed fixtures?

Yes, but ensure the bulbs are rated for enclosed fixtures to avoid overheating. Verify the packaging for compatibility details.

3. What is the environmental impact of LED A19 bulbs?

LED A19 bulbs are eco-friendly, consuming less energy, reducing greenhouse gas emissions and containing no toxic materials like mercury.

4. Are LED A19 bulbs dimmable?

Many LED A19 bulbs are dimmable, but check the packaging for specification. Using compatible dimmer switches enhances performance.

5. How do I choose the right color temperature for my room?

Select color temperature based on room function: warm white for relaxation areas, cool white for kitchens, and daylight for reading or working.
